  • probably the most original cleanest low hours b6000 on youtube .
    i have never seen one in better condition. this tractor is 1973 and has only 600 hours on the clock. it is in non restored original condition. the most iconic kubota made, a legend of a machine for being reliable and strong.

    It is really in a very nice condition, but I don`t think it is 100% original. The engine is the original one, though I`m not sure if they were equipped with an hour - meter. But, the operator`s platform doesn`t look original. The B5000, B6000 and B7000 had thin "steps" on each side, and on the right hand side, there were only 3 pedals; the two brakes and the differential lock. This one has flat steps and a gas pedal, just like the next models, B5001, B6001 and B7001. And there`s the transmission too, you see, the seat mounts and the seat itself are also from a B6001. I have a feeling that the front part of the tractor, anything that is in front of the clutch, including the dash panel, is original.The rear part of the tractor (the little alloy label over the main shaft, steps, seat and hydraulic system - so perhaps the gearbox too) seems like the rear part of a Β6001. I`m not meaning to embarass you in any way - I just love these tractors and I`m telling you some "strange" issues I noticed on this one, which, anyway, is pretty good!
